Description

Stag Cottage is a remarkably beautiful Listed building, reputed to be the oldest property in Heptonstall, built in Elizabethan times (C1580).

Stag Cottage oozes charm and retains many original features, including stone mullioned windows, arched lintels, wooden beams and a king post truss with wattle and daub. It is nestled in the heart of the old village, away from the main road but within a stone's throw of all the village amenities. The Cottage sleeps 3 adults with a kingsize bedroom together with a single bedroom. A 4ft 6' high beam separates the kitchen from the living area.

Heptonstall is a beautiful and historic hill top village situated in the heart of Calderdale, West Yorkshire, some 500 feet above the popular and bustling town of Hebden Bridge. The village has a post office, a cafe and two thriving pubs.

The surrounding countryside is breathtaking, ideal for walking and cycling, including the nearby National Trust owned Hardcastle Crags. There are literary links to both the Brontë family in nearby Haworth and to Ted Hughes and his wife Sylvia Plath, who is buried in the village churchyard. The unique and popular town of Hebden Bridge is just a short walk down the hill, offering dozens of independent shops, galleries, restaurants and cafes.
